UITk MultiColumnListView Control is missing callbacks when being removed
A few issues we have in using the MultiColumnListView in hierarchy
- There is no Dispose function to control when to clear all elements
- Unbind is not called on the various cells when we close the HierarchyWindow
* UnbindAll is not public on controller. I have a reflection hack for this.
DestroyCell is NEVER called since the Column is always null in MultiColumnController.DestroyItem(VisualElement element)
- There is no way when quitting the HierarchyWindow to ensure DestroyCell is called on all active elements.
** I tried ListView.itemsSource = null;ListView.Rebuild(); and it didn't work
** the list of active items was empty when Rebuild got called.
** When the active items pool is cleared, we don't call destroyItem

Resolution Note (fix version 2023.3):
Fixed the multicolumn list view's destroyCell not being called when setting its itemsSource to null and calling a rebuild.
